Default This T is a B HELP!!!!!

I,m trying to insatll my hurst right now. I have the vicegrips and a hammer. Which way did you guys put the vicegrips on. Side to side or front to back. And which way should I tap the T. I'm trying to stay cool so i'm taking a break and asking you guys. Thanks :cheers: :cheers:

I clamped them on front to back as a I couldn't get a decent purchase on the demon key otherwise. I remember a lot of tugging, levering and swearing before it came free. Good luck !

Same here, front to back. Gotta pull straight up. If you can get something into your vise grips crossways (screwdriver, small wrench?), it may give you something to hammer upwards on. Kind of a slide hammer impact effect. You can do a search and see a lot of very creative approachs to this. If you have a helper they can swear along with you. :D

Be sure to keep your face away from the grips. When that thing lets loose, you could lose some teeth or an eye.

After you tried the vice grips/hammer method, even the screwdriver method, and the T (also called Demon Key) is still in, drop me an IM and I will send you the correct tools!

Whatever you do, be sure not to destroy the sides of the key, otherwise you will have nothing to grip on!

Clamp those vice grips on the Demon Key front to back, then tap on the vice grips with a hammer while pulling up. :cheers:
